About the Role

Under supervision, the Contracts Specialist is responsible for the direction, development, and implementation of all contracts aligned with organizational needs. This role also manages, oversees, and monitors contractual relationships and compliance with contracted community providers, as well as support and administrative vendors.

Responsibilities
  • Serve as a liaison to oversee all contracted service agreements and collaborate with contracted providers and service entities (administrative and support).
  • Partner closely with the Medical Director to recruit qualified specialist physicians for the provider network.
  • Coordinate contracting terms, negotiations, and activities between the organization and contractors.
  • Conduct ongoing monitoring to ensure compliance with credentialing standards and identify any concerns related to professional conduct or performance.
  • Prepare all contractor agreements (provider and administrative/support) for final approval and execution by leadership.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ned to support contractual operations and organizational goals.
Qualifications
  • Education: Bachelor’s degree (BA/BS) preferred
  • Licensure/Certifications: Valid driver’s license required
  • Experience: Minimum of 3 years of experience in healthcare contracting within a managed care environment

Knowledge & Skills:

  • Strong understanding of medical contracting, including reimbursement methodologies, compliance requirements, and contract structures
  • Experience with Medi-Cal, Medicare, Medicare Advantage, and commercial contracting models
  • Excellent verbal, written, organizational, and interpersonal skills
  • Strong analytical capabilities, including basic financial analysis
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Access) and database/tracking systems
